Featured image of post 高效提示工程的解决方案:poml 语言助力大型语言模型优化 | 开源日报 No.702

高效提示工程的解决方案:poml 语言助力大型语言模型优化 | 开源日报 No.702

poml 是一种新型标记语言,专为大型语言模型 (LLM) 的高级提示工程设计,采用类 HTML 语法,支持结构化提示和多种数据类型嵌入,提升提示的可读性和复用性。它引入类似 CSS 的样式系统,支持动态生成提示内容,提供丰富的开发工具和 SDK,便于与主流应用和 LLM 框架的集成。

microsoft/poml

Github Repo Stars License: `MIT` Language: `Unknown`

cover

poml 是一种专为大型语言模型(LLM)高级提示工程设计的新型标记语言。

  • 采用类 HTML 语法,使用语义化组件如 、 和 实现结构化提示,提升提示的可读性、复用性和维护性。
  • 支持多种数据类型嵌入,如文本文件、表格和图片,通过专门的数据标签无缝集成外部数据源,并提供格式定制选项。
  • 引入类似 CSS 的样式系统,实现内容与展示分离,可通过样式表或内联属性灵活调整输出格式,有效降低对 LLM 格式敏感性的影响。
  • 内置模板引擎支持变量替换、循环及条件判断,方便动态生成复杂且数据驱动的提示内容。
  • 提供丰富开发工具,包括 Visual Studio Code 扩展(支持语法高亮、自动补全、实时预览及错误诊断)以及 Node.js 和 Python SDK,实现与主流应用流程及 LLM 框架的无缝集成。

go2coding/go2coding.github.io

Github Repo Stars License: `NOASSERTION` Language: `Unknown`

cover

go2coding.github.io 是一个专注于人工智能工具的导航网站,提供了多种免费的 AI 资源和服务。

  • 最新 AI 产品介绍,帮助用户了解行业动态并快速选择合适的产品。
  • 汇总开源优秀项目,为用户提供学习和参考资料。
  • 推荐国内外的 AI 学习资源,从初学者到专业人士都能找到适合自己的路径。
  • 介绍主流的 AI 学习框架,便捷地帮助用户了解、选择和使用。

LlamaFamily/Llama-Chinese

Github Repo Stars License: `NOASSERTION` Language: `Unknown`

demo-picture-of-Llama-Chinese

Llama-Chinese 是一个专注于中文优化的开源大模型社区,致力于提供最好的中文 Llama 大模型体验和微调服务。

  • 提供最新的 Llama3 学习资料和在线体验
  • 支持多种快速上手方法,如 Anaconda、Docker 等
  • 拥有强大的技术支持团队,提供专业指导
  • 定期组织线上活动与技术研讨,促进创新交流

threadsjs/threads.js

Github Repo Stars License: `MIT` Language: `Unknown`

cover

threads.js 是一个用于与 Threads API 交互的 Node.js 库。

  • 面向对象设计
  • 高性能
  • 支持身份验证
  • 100% 测试覆盖率
  • 简单的安装和更新方式

Tanza3D/reddark

Github Repo Stars License: `AGPL-3.0` Language: `Unknown`

cover

reddark 是一个实时监控 subreddit 变暗的网站。

  • 实时显示参与的 subreddit 列表
  • 从 r/ModCoord 线程中提取参与的 subreddit 信息
  • 使用 Express 托管前端,Socket.io 提供数据服务
  • 简单易懂的代码结构,便于理解和使用
Licensed under CC BY-NC-SA 4.0